ALERT: Webhook delivery retries exhausted for Quillbridge outbound events. The dispatcher retries failed deliveries five times with exponential backoff (base 30s, capped at 15 minutes), after which events move to the dead-letter queue. Note that a 410 response halts retries immediately and disables the endpoint, while 5xx and timeouts count toward the retry budget. Do not manually requeue without checking endpoint health first. The full retry semantics and replay procedure are documented on the internal page below.

wiki page, bajog-tahop: https://confluence.qorvelsys.internal/browse/pages/pages/pages

To: Executive Team
Subject: Licensing dispute — Pellar Systems

Colleagues, Pellar Systems has formally contested our continued use of the Quindell rendering module, claiming the 2022 amendment lapsed. Counsel at Harven & Moss believes our position is defensible but recommends settlement talks before arbitration. Engineering confirms a replacement module is three months out. No customer impact expected short term. Board context on our negotiating posture follows below.

management briefing: The renewal with Quenaelox Group closes at $2 million a year, 15 percent below the last contract. Project Holwyn slips by six weeks because of the tooling delay.

**Ticket: Upgrade Quillbus broker to v4 on the Harrowgate cluster**

Support-facing summary: we are upgrading the Quillbus message broker this Thursday. Expect a five-minute window where queued notifications from the Pellworth dashboard are delayed, not lost. No customer action needed. If a customer reports duplicate messages after the window, attach their report to this ticket. When escalating to engineering, include the broker build token shown below.

session token of tajef-bageg = htk21_5d90d574934f3ccae6437